Property Appraisals Subject To IRS Review

In reviewing a person’s income tax return the IRS may accept the donated property value or make its own determination of fair market value. District Director Ellis Campbell Jr. said the IRS may request more information refer the case to an appraiser or hire an independent appraiser. Independent appraisers are often used for donated items such as books collections paintings stamps coins jewelry gems phonographs firearms antique furniture and manuscripts.

State Capital Highlights Pay Raises and Welfare Changes

The Legislature approved a broad pay raise for about 240,000 state and education employees to be phased in from November 14. Teachers gain five percent annually under a 1969 plan, while state employees receive 6.8 percent via a supplemental November payroll. Welfare and food stamp reforms expand eligibility and benefits, including non-citizen eligibility for permanent residents and waivers on guardianship rules. Oil production allowances rise to 63 percent for December as stocks decline, with actual output near forecasts.

Governor appoints new Texas alcohol and veterinary board members

Gov. Preston Smith named Robert L. Thornton Jr. of Dallas to the Texas Alcoholic Beverage Commission succeeding Alfred Negley of San Antonio. Smith also appointed Dr. Dan J. Anderson of Fort Worth and Dr. John E. Wilkins Jr. of Greenville to the State Board of Veterinary Medical Examiners. Sen. O. H. Harris of Dallas was elected chairman and Lamar Golding of Huntsville vice chairman of a senate committee studying feasibility of pari mutuel horse racing in Texas. Fritz Lanham of Austin, an aide to Smith, was placed on the Criminal Justice Council executive committee.

Opinions Outline Dual Roles for Officials in State Agencies

A local civil service commissioner may hold simultaneous posts as assistant postmaster or tax board member, per Attorney General Crawford C. Martin. Martin also says taxable property valuation in education code equals assessed valuation, and only the prior year’s county assessment may set criteria for county junior college districts. The state comptroller may refund protested taxes within the assessment period, and Senatorial district conventions next May must be held in districts drawn by the Legislative Redistricting Board. Secretary of State Bullock, as chief election officer, issued the ruling.

Pilgrims, Socialism, and the First Thanksgiving Lesson

Omar Burleson reflects on the Pilgrims 1620 Mayflower Compact and their shift from communal to private enterprise. He cites Bradford text noting common ownership bred confusion and hardship, then highlights 1623 gratitude for deliverance from socialism and the enduring claim that socialism fails by moral law.

Major M W Nelson Assigned To Duty At Ent AFB

Maj. M. W. Nelson, son of Mrs. A M Nelson of Winters, reports for duty at Ent AFB Colorado. An air operations officer in Aerospace Defense Command, he previously served at Loring AFB Maine and has 11 months in Vietnam. He earned a 1956 BA from Texas Tech and is a Phi Delta Theta member. his wife Robby Dale is from Kilgore.
